67th Filmfare Awards: Ranveer Singh, Kriti Sanon Win Top Honours; Check Complete List

Date:

Mumbai: Bollywood actor Ranveer Singh won the Best Actor in a Lead Role (Male) award for his cricket drama ’83’ at the 67th Filmfare Awards in Mumbai, while Kriti Sanon bagged the Best Actor in a Lead Role (female) award for ‘Mimi’.

Ranveer shared the stage with his wife Deepika Padukone while accepting the “black lady” on Tuesday night.

Prior to Filmfare, Ranveer was given the Best Actor award for his performance in ’83’ at The Indian Film Festival of Melbourne (IFFM) 2022.

Helmed by Kabir Khan, ’83’ revolves around India’s historical 1983 Cricket World Cup win. The movie features Ranveer as Kapil Dev, captain of the World Cup-winning team.

Speaking of Kriti Sanon, she was honoured for her performance in ‘Mimi’, which was released in 2021.

In ‘Mimi’, Kriti essayed the role of a surrogate mother. The film is directed by Laxman Utekar.

Earlier in May 2022, Kriti won her career’s first best actress award and that too at the 22nd International Indian Film Academy Awards in Abu Dhabi.

Sidharth Malhotra-starrer Shershaah and Ranveer Singh’s 83 were the top nominees at the awards. The two films have bagged 19 and 15 nominations, respectively, closely followed by Vicky Kaushal-starrer Sardar Udham and Taapsee Pannu-led Rashmi Rocket with 13 and 11 nods each.

Filmfare Awards complete winners list:

Best Film – Shershaah

Best Film (Critics) – Sardar Udham

Best Actor in a Leading Role (Male) – Ranveer Singh (83)

Best Actor (Critics) – Vicky Kaushal (Sardar Udham)

Best Actor in a Leading Role (Female) – Kriti Sanon (Mimi)

Best Actress (Critics) – Vidya Balan (Sherni)

Best Director – Vishnuvardhan (Shershaah)

Best Actor in a Supporting Role (Male) – Pankaj Tripathi (Mimi)

Best Actor in a Supporting Role (Female) – Sai Tamhankar (Mimi)

Best Music Album – Tanishk Bagchi, B Praak, Jaani, Jasleen Royal, Javed-mohsin And Vikram Montrose (Shershaah)

Best Lyrics – Kausar Munir for Lehra Do (83)

Best Playback Singer (Male) – B Praak for Mann Bharryaa (Shershaah)

Best Playback Singer (Female) – Asees Kaur for Raataan Lambiyan (Shershaah)

Best Action – Stefan Richter And Suniel Rodrigues (Shershaah)

Best Background Score – Shantanu Moitra (Sardar Udham)

Best Choreography – Vijay Ganguly for Chaka Chak (Atrangi Re)

Best Cinematography – Avik Mukhopadhyay for Sardar Udham

Best Costume – Veera Kapur Ee for Sardar Udham

Best Editing – A. Sreekar Prasad for Shershaah

Best Production Design – Mansi Dhruv Mehta And Dmitrii Malich for Sardar Udham

Best Sound Design – Dipankar Chaki And Nihar Ranjan Samal for Sardar Udham

Best VFX – Superb/bojp Main Road Post Ny Vfxwaala Edit Fx Studios for Sardar Udham

Best Dialogue – Dibaker Banerjee and Varun Grover for Sandeep Aur Pinky Faraar

Best Screenplay – Shubhendu Bhattacharya and Ritesh Shah for Sardar Udham

Best Story – Abhishek Kapoor, Supratik Sen, and Tushar Paranjape for Chandigarh Kare Aashiqui

Best Debut Director – Seema Pahwa (Ramprasad Ki Tehrvi)

Best Debut Female – Sharvari Wagh (Bunty Aur Babli 2)

Best Debut Male – Ehan Bhat (99 Songs)

Lifetime Achievement Award – Subhash Ghai
